After Mein Kampf? (1961)
Synopsis
By combining actual footage with reenactments, this film offers both a documentary and fictional account of the life of Adolf Hitler, from his childhood in Vienna, through the rise of the Third Reich, to his final act of suicide in the waning days of WWII. The film also provides considerable, and often shocking, detail of the atrocities enacted by the Nazi regime under Hitler's command.
Release Date: 1961-08-01
Runtime: 43 minutes
Director: Ralph Porter
